How do use the word telegram in a sentence?

Here are a few ways to use the word "telegram" in a sentence:

Basic usage:

* My grandmother received a telegram from her brother overseas.

* The news of the war was delivered by telegram.

* He sent a telegram to his wife announcing his arrival.

Figurative language:

* The message was like a telegram – short, direct, and to the point.

* The rumors spread with the speed of a telegram across the town.

Historical context:

* In the 19th century, telegrams were the fastest way to communicate over long distances.

* Before the internet, telegrams were used extensively in business and government.
